  • the present invention relates to the field of liquid crystal display, and in particular to a liquid crystal display device. Background technique
  • Liquid crystal display has many advantages such as thin body, power saving, and no radiation, and has been widely used.
  • Most of the liquid crystal display devices on the market are backlight type liquid crystal displays, which include a liquid crystal panel and a backlight module.
  • the working principle of the liquid crystal panel is to place liquid crystal molecules in two parallel glass. There are many vertical and horizontal small wires between the two glass plates.
  • the liquid crystal molecules are controlled to change direction by energization or not, and the light of the backlight module is refracted. Picture. Since the liquid crystal panel itself does not emit light, it is necessary to display the image normally by the light source provided by the backlight module. Therefore, the backlight module becomes one of the key components of the liquid crystal display device.
  • the backlight module is divided into a side-in type backlight module and a direct-type backlight module according to different incident positions of the light source.
  • a light source such as a CCFL (Cold Cathode Fluorescent Lamp) or an LED (Light Emitting Diode) is disposed behind the liquid crystal panel, and a surface light source is directly formed and supplied to the liquid crystal panel.
  • CCFL Cold Cathode Fluorescent Lamp
  • LED Light Emitting Diode
  • the side-lit backlight module is provided with an LED light bar disposed on the edge of the back panel behind the liquid crystal panel, and the light emitted by the LED strip enters the light guide plate from the light incident surface of the light guide plate, and is reflected and After being diffused, it is emitted from the light-emitting surface of the light guide plate to form a surface light source to be supplied to the liquid crystal panel.

液晶显示装置 技术领域
本发明涉及液晶显示领域, 尤其涉及一种液晶显示装置。 背景技术
液晶显示装置 (LCD, Liquid Crystal Display )具有机身薄、 省电、 无 辐射等众多优点, 得到了广泛的应用。 现有市场上的液晶显示装置大部分 为背光型液晶显示器, 其包括液晶面板及背光模组(backlight module ) 。 液晶面板的工作原理是在两片平行的玻璃当中放置液晶分子, 两片玻璃中 间有许多垂直和水平的细小电线, 通过通电与否来控制液晶分子改变方 向, 将背光模组的光线折射出来产生画面。 由于液晶面板本身不发光, 需 要借由背光模组提供的光源来正常显示影像, 因此, 背光模组成为液晶显 示装置的关键组件之一。 背光模组依照光源入射位置的不同分成侧入式背 光模组与直下式背光模组两种。 直下式背光模组是将发光光源例如 CCFL(Cold Cathode Fluorescent Lamp , 阴极萤光灯管)或 LED(Light Emitting Diode发光二极管)设置在液晶面板后方, 直接形成面光源提供给 液晶面板。 而侧入式背光模组是将发光光源 LED 灯条(lightbar )设于液 晶面板侧后方的背板边缘, LED灯条发出的光线从导光板一侧的入光面进 入导光板, 经反射和扩散后从导光板出光面出射, 以形成面光源提供给液 晶面板。
请参阅图 1 , 液晶显示装置一般包括: 背光模组 100、 设于背光模组 100上的胶框 300、 设于胶框 300上的液晶显示面板 500及设于液晶显示 面板 500上的前壳 700, 所述背光模组 100 包括背板 102、 设于背板 100 内的导光板 104、 设于背板 102 内的背光源 (未图示) , 该背光模组 100 用于给液晶显示面板 500提供光照均匀的面光源, 所述胶框 300用于承载 液晶显示面板 500, 前壳 700将液晶显示面板 500固定于胶框 300内, 液 晶显示面板 500包括 TFT (薄膜晶体管)基板 502、 与 TFT基板 502相对 贴合设置的 CF (彩膜滤光片 )基板 504及设于 TFT基板 502与 CF基板 504之间的液晶 (未图示) , 该 TFT基板 502与 CF基板 504贴合后, 在 TFT基板 502边缘位置形成有断差位置 524, 该断差位置 524用于贴附软 性线路板 ( COF ) 526以为液晶显示面板 500提供驱动电压。
所述前壳 700 —般由塑胶材料制成, 以控制生产成本, 所述背板 102 一般由金属材料制成, 如铁, 以保证背光模组 100 的强度。 该种结构的液 晶显示装置会导致软性线路板 526产生的静电无法释放, 可能出现静电击 穿软性线路板 526与 IC (半导体元件 ) (未图示) 的问题, 进而影响液晶 显示装置的品质。
针对上述问题, 中国专利 (申请号: 201210068995.6 )公开一种液晶 显示装置 (如图 2所示) , 从外到内依次包括相互配合固定的前壳 100,、 胶框 300,和背板 500,, 所述前壳 100,和胶框 300,之间夹持有液晶面板 700' , 所述前壳 100,采用绝缘材料, 所述前壳 100,的表面设有导电膜 102' , 所述背板 500,采用导电材料, 所述导电膜 102,和背板 500,之间连接 有导电部件 502,, 所述导电膜 102,通过所述导电部件 502,跟所述背板 500, 电连接。 本发明通过导电部件 502,将导电膜 102,和导电材质的背板 500,相 连接, 柔性电路板(未图示)产生的静电可以通过导电膜 102,释放到背板 500,上, 有效避免电路板和 IC的被静电击穿。
上述方案虽然有效解决了静电释放的问题, 但却存在如下问题: 1、 连通前壳和背板的导电部件会造成塑胶前壳的成本优势下降;
2、 粘贴导电部件会造成人力成本的浪费;
3、 导电部件粘贴后, 可能会有脱落的风险, 造成品质上的风险。 发明内容
本发明的目的在于提供一种液晶显示装置, 其能有效释放静电, 使用 寿命长, 且结构简单, 易组装, 利于成本控制。

为更进一步阐述本发明所采取的技术手段及其效果, 以下结合本发明 的优选实施例及其附图进行详细描述。
请参阅图 3 至图 5 , 本发明提供一种液晶显示装置, 包括: 背光模组
2、 设于背光模组 2上的胶框 4、 设于胶框 4上的液晶显示面板 6及设于液 晶显示面板 6上的前壳 8。
所述背光模组 2 包括背板 22、 设于背板 22 内的背光源 (未图示)及 设于背板 22内的导光板 24, 所述背板 22由导电材料制成, 该背板 22包 括底板 222及连接底板 222的数个侧板 224, 至少一侧板 224由外表面向 外设有数个凸起部 226 , 所述前壳 8 由塑胶材料制成, 其对应该一侧板
224 的内表面上设有导电薄膜 28, 在本实施例中, 所述导电薄膜 28 为导 电铝箔, 该导电薄膜 28 —端与液晶显示面板 6接触设置, 另一端与凸起 部 226接触设置, 进而形成通路, 以释放静电, 有效保护软性线路板(未 图示)及 IC (未图示) 。
所述胶框 4由塑胶材料制成, 其对应凸起部 226设有开口部 42, 所述 凸起部 226穿过开口部 42抵靠于导电薄膜 28上。 所述胶框 4对应液晶显 示面板 6设有承载部 44, 所述液晶显示面板 6承载于该承载部 44上。 所述液晶显示面板 6包括 TFT基板 62、 与 TFT基板 62相对贴合设置 的 CF基板 64及设于 TFT基板 62与 CF基板 64之间的液晶 (未图示) 。
所述 TFT基板 62与 CF基板 64贴合后在 CF基板 64边缘位置形成断 差位置 642, —软性线路板(未图示)贴合于该断差位置 642 上, 该软性 线路板用于为液晶显示面板 6提供驱动电压, 以驱动液晶分子, 进而实现 画面显示。
所述液晶显示面板 6还包括贴合于 TFT基板 62远离 CF基板 64表面 的第一偏光片 66及贴合于 CF基板 64远离 TFT基板 62表面的第二偏光 片 68。
所述背光模组 2还包括设于底板 222与导光板 24之间的反射片 26及 设于导光板 24上的光学膜片组 27, 所述背光源发出的光线直接或经由反 射片 26反射后进入导光板 24 内, 该光线在导光板 24 内传播, 为液晶显 示面板 6提供光照均匀的面光源。
本发明液晶显示装置还包括与前壳 8配合设置的后壳 10, 在本实施例 中, 所述前壳 8与后壳 10卡合设置, 进而将背光模组 2、 胶框 4及液晶显 示面板 6固定于前壳 8与后壳 10之间, 组装成液晶显示装置。
综上所述, 本发明的液晶显示装置, 通过在背光模组的背板的侧板上 设置凸起部, 在前壳的内表面设置导电薄膜, 该导电薄膜一端与液晶显示 面板接触设置, 另一端与凸起部接触设置, 进而形成通路, 有效释放静 电, 避免静电击穿软性线路板与 IC , 延长了液晶显示装置的使用寿命, 且, 结构简单, 易组装, 有效降低生产成本。
